Breaking Down the Features of Labconco XPert Balance Enclosures, Labconco 3971800

Specifications

  • The Labconco XPert Balance Enclosures, Labconco 3971800 features a sturdy, glacier white and gray, dry powder epoxy-coated aluminum frame and steel rear plenum. This dissipates static charge which is critical for accurate balance readings.
  • It is constructed with tempered safety glass for the front sash, sides, and top. This provides excellent visibility, ambient light, and user protection.
  • The interior height is 59.4 cm (23 13/32″), and the operating sash height is 20.3 cm (8″). This conservative sash height limits exhaust demand and conserves tempered room air.
  • The enclosure comes with two 5.1 x 25.4 cm (2×10″) rectangular exhaust collars on the top and bottom. These allow for connection to ductwork or a portable exhauster.
  • Optional features include a built-in airflow monitor with audible alarm. This provides an additional layer of safety by alerting the user to insufficient airflow.

These specifications contribute directly to the Labconco XPert Balance Enclosures, Labconco 3971800’s effectiveness. Static dissipation ensures accurate measurements, while the airflow monitor offers critical real-time safety feedback.

Performance & Functionality

The Labconco XPert Balance Enclosures, Labconco 3971800 excels at containing powders, particulates, and fumes during weighing procedures. The Clean-Sweep airfoil and perforated rear baffle work in tandem to create a horizontal laminar airflow, maximizing containment. The ergonomic angled sash allows for a closer view and more comfortable operating position.

Accessories and Customization Options

The Labconco XPert Balance Enclosures, Labconco 3971800 offers a range of accessories to enhance its functionality. These include remote blowers, stainless steel work surfaces, utility shelf kits, and airflow monitors. It is compatible with Labconco’s FilterMate portable exhausters.

The availability of these accessories allows users to tailor the enclosure to their specific needs and applications. The optional airflow monitors provide an additional layer of safety, while the stainless steel work surfaces offer enhanced chemical resistance.
